A Clash of Fortunes: SC Bastia vs SM Caen
In the picturesque setting of Corsica, SC Bastia is set to host SM Caen in what promises to be a captivating encounter in Ligue 2. The home side, SC Bastia, has been navigating a whirlwind of events both on and off the pitch. The recent suspension of the Corsican derby against AC Ajaccio due to crowd disturbances has added an extra layer of intrigue to their season. Despite these distractions, Bastia has shown resilience, securing a notable victory against Guingamp and drawing against formidable opponents like Lorient and Clermont Foot 63. The club's strategic moves, including the appointment of Frédéric Antonetti as technical director, signal a commitment to strengthening their leadership and tactical approach.
SM Caen's Struggles and Transitions
On the other hand, SM Caen finds itself in a precarious position, languishing at 17th place in the table. The team is in the throes of a dismal run, having lost their last six matches. The departure of key players like Johann Lepenant to Lyon and Alexis Beka Beka to Lokomotiv Moscow has further weakened their squad. However, the signing of Johann Obiang offers a glimmer of hope for the Normandy club. Off the pitch, rumors of a potential takeover by Kylian Mbappe's family could herald a new era for Caen, but for now, their focus remains on halting their slide down the standings.
Historical Context and Head-to-Head Analysis
Historically, encounters between SC Bastia and SM Caen have been closely contested. The most frequent scoreline when Bastia hosts Caen is a 1-1 draw, a result that has occurred four times. However, Bastia holds a slight edge at home, with six wins in their last 14 meetings against Caen. Despite this, Caen has been a thorn in Bastia's side recently, winning four of their last five encounters. Last season, Caen emerged victorious in both fixtures against Bastia, including a 2-1 win away from home.
Prediction and Key Factors
Given the current form and circumstances, SC Bastia appears to have the upper hand. Their home record this season is impressive, with eight wins, seven draws, and just one loss. In contrast, Caen's away form is abysmal, with only two wins and twelve losses. Bastia's ability to score, particularly in the first half, could be pivotal, as they win 81% of matches when leading at halftime. However, both teams have shown vulnerabilities in defense, with Bastia conceding in their last five matches and Caen in their last eight. This suggests that while Bastia is likely to secure a victory, both teams could find the net. Expect a hard-fought match with Bastia edging out Caen, perhaps in a 2-1 scoreline.
